Ever imagined passing the FE on the first try 7 years after school, doing the same with the PE just 2 years later…and all of this without having started out in engineering in the first place?!

That’s exactly what today’s guest did! 😮

Sierra Patrick was on a pre-med track before realizing engineering suited her better. Two years ago, she joined our Civil FE Review Course to finally tackle the FE exam after putting it off since college.

Fast forward to today, she’s officially a licensed PE after knocking out the PE Exam this year with our Civil PE Review Course as well. (Yep, another double-win with CEA! ✅ 👷)
